Amniotic Membrane Market: Market Size & Forecast 2026

The global amniotic membrane market is valued at approximately $16.53 billion in 2025 and is expanding at a compound annual growth rate of roughly 10.79 percent. Amniotic membranes and their derivatives, sourced from placental tissue and processed into grafts, patches, and injectable preparations, are used across ophthalmology, wound care, orthopedics, plastic surgery, and dental medicine. Growth is driven by rising prevalence of chronic wounds, increasing adoption of regenerative biologics over synthetic alternatives, and an aging population requiring surgical and reconstructive interventions. The market benefits from ongoing advances in cryopreservation and tissue-engineering technologies that expand product shelf life and clinical utility.

Market Overview

The amniotic membrane market encompasses products derived from human placental tissue, including amnion, chorion, and amniotic fluid preparations processed into allografts, sheets, and injectable biologics. These biomaterials serve as scaffolds and signaling platforms that reduce inflammation, inhibit scarring, and promote tissue regeneration. Regulatory frameworks such as those enforced by the FDA classify many of these products as orthobiologics, subjecting them to safety and manufacturing standards that vary by classification pathway.

  • Products include cryopreserved grafts, dehydrated patches, and amniotic fluid-derived injectables used in ophthalmic, wound-healing, and orthopedic applications
  • The broader tissue engineering market that includes amniotic membrane products is projected to reach $43.13 billion by 2030 at a 14.3% CAGR
  • No single government agency publishes an official statistical figure specifically for the amniotic membrane market; estimates are derived from industry research

Growth Drivers

The market is fueled by the growing global burden of chronic and acute wounds, including diabetic foot ulcers and venous leg ulcers, for which amniotic membrane products offer biological alternatives to conventional dressings. Advances in cryopreservation have extended the shelf life and usability of these tissues, supporting broader clinical adoption. Additionally, the shift toward regenerative medicine and away from purely synthetic biomaterials has increased surgeon and patient preference for biologically active perinatal tissues.

  • The wound care biomaterials sector, closely tied to amniotic membrane demand, is expected to reach $18.7 billion by 2030 with an 11.3% CAGR
  • The cell cryopreservation market supporting amniotic tissue storage is growing at 11.40% annually
  • Regenerative therapy markets leveraging perinatal tissues are expanding at an 11.43% CAGR through 2030

Segmentation and Regional Analysis

The market is segmented by product type, application, and end user. Product categories include grafts, scaffolds, and cell- and fluid-based preparations. Clinical applications span ophthalmology, particularly for ocular surface reconstruction and cicatrizing conjunctivitis, wound management, orthopedic surgery, and dental procedures. Geographically, North America leads in market share due to advanced healthcare infrastructure and regulatory pathways supporting biologic approvals, while Europe and Asia-Pacific are expanding rapidly as healthcare systems increase access to regenerative therapies.

  • Ophthalmic and chronic wound-healing applications represent the largest clinical segments
  • Hospitals and specialty wound-care clinics are the primary end users; ambulatory surgical centers are a growing distribution channel
  • Asia-Pacific is projected to be the fastest-growing regional market as adoption of biologic therapies accelerates

Trends and Outlook

What are the recent trends and outlook?

The market is trending toward minimally processed, minimally manipulated products that preserve native extracellular matrix components and growth factors. Combination approaches pairing amniotic membranes with stem cells or other biologics are emerging as next-generation regenerative therapies. As clinical evidence accumulates and reimbursement pathways evolve, the market is expected to sustain double-digit growth through 2030, closely aligned with broader advances in orthobiologics and tissue engineering.

  • Combination biologic products integrating amniotic membranes with cellular therapies are gaining clinical and commercial momentum
  • Reimbursement policy development will be a critical determinant of market access and growth trajectory
  • Continued product innovation in preservation techniques and combination formulations is expected to sustain the market's roughly 10-11% annual growth rate
